Python實(shí)現(xiàn)奇數(shù)偶數(shù)分開(kāi)打印
在Python語(yǔ)言中,我們可以利用while循環(huán)和if判斷語(yǔ)句,將1-50之間的奇數(shù)和偶數(shù)分開(kāi),并分別存儲(chǔ)在兩個(gè)列表中。下面通過(guò)一個(gè)具體的示例來(lái)演示如何實(shí)現(xiàn)這一操作: 第一步:設(shè)置初始變量A并使用wh
在Python語(yǔ)言中,我們可以利用while循環(huán)和if判斷語(yǔ)句,將1-50之間的奇數(shù)和偶數(shù)分開(kāi),并分別存儲(chǔ)在兩個(gè)列表中。下面通過(guò)一個(gè)具體的示例來(lái)演示如何實(shí)現(xiàn)這一操作:
第一步:設(shè)置初始變量A并使用while循環(huán)打印數(shù)字
首先,在PyCharm設(shè)計(jì)工具中新建一個(gè)Python文件,并定義變量A并賦值為1。接著使用while循環(huán)語(yǔ)句打印變量A的值,代碼如下所示:
```python
A 1
while A < 50:
print(A)
A 1
```
第二步:打印1-50之間的偶數(shù)
如果只想打印1到50之間的偶數(shù),可以利用取模運(yùn)算符%來(lái)判斷數(shù)字的奇偶性。修改代碼如下:
```python
A 1
while A < 50:
if A % 2 0:
print(A)
A 1
```
第三步:將奇數(shù)和偶數(shù)分別存儲(chǔ)在列表中
為了將奇數(shù)和偶數(shù)分開(kāi)存儲(chǔ),我們可以定義兩個(gè)空列表B和C,然后在while循環(huán)中根據(jù)數(shù)字的奇偶性將其添加到相應(yīng)的列表中。完整代碼如下:
```python
A 1
B []
C []
while A < 50:
if A % 2 0:
(A)
else:
(A)
A 1
print("偶數(shù)列表B:", B)
print("奇數(shù)列表C:", C)
```
通過(guò)以上步驟,我們成功將1-50之間的奇數(shù)和偶數(shù)分開(kāi)打印,并存儲(chǔ)在了兩個(gè)不同的列表中。這種方法不僅實(shí)現(xiàn)了功能需求,還展示了Python中列表的靈活運(yùn)用。